Music/RadioThe Top Twelve Biggest Topics In The Nigerian Music Industry 2021 by Synord(op): 4:24pm On Jan 01, 2022
The Year 2021 is one of the most fulfilling years for Afrobeats and The Nigerian Music industry in General . A lot of happenings occurred during the course of the year but here are the top twelve major topics that were recurrent and generated the most reactions and commentary in the Nigerian music industry among music listeners and critics in Nigeria and across Africa as a whole .

1. Burna Boy Grammy– Burna Boy won the Best Global Music Award Category with his Fifth studio album “ Twice as Tall” at the 63rd Grammy awards ceremony that took place in Los Angeles on the 14th of March, 2020.

He won the category with his critically acclaimed fifth album “ Twice as Tall” boasting of hit songs like “ Onyeka” , 23, Real Life , Bebo and Alarm . The album features Stormzy Naughty by Nature , Sauti Sol , Chris Martin and Youssouf N’Dour and production credits to Timbaland , Diddy , P2J, Leriq, Telz and others

. Burna Boy became the first contemporary Nigeria artiste to clinch the coveted award which is regarded as the highest honors in Contemporary music .

The award was very special to Burna Boy and Nigerians because the previous year , burna boy did not win the Grammy award for “Africa Giant”, his 2020 album which was nominated for Best World music album. He lost to Angelique kidjo” Celia”.

The Grammy award caused an uproar on twitter and trended for days on social media platforms . Burna Boy while giving his acceptance speech encouraged youths to go for their dreams and let nothing stop them .

2. Wizkid at the 02- Wizkid sold out his 02 arena shows in seconds and had to make provisions for three different nights. The ticket sales were record breaking , selling out in seconds and landed Wizkid in the list of 7 musicians to ever to sell out 02 tickets within 15 minutes .


The show itself was glamorous and featured performances from Skepta, Chris brown, Maleek Berry , Lojay, Ckay, Bella Shmurda, Blaqbonez , Tems among others . Fans and critics rated the show highly and it reportedly earned wizkid over 2.5 million dollars .

Nairaland GeneralTop Ten Bizarre And Discriminatory Laws Against Women In Nigeria by Synord(op):
Nigeria is one of Africa’s most populous countries with women forming approximately 49 percent of the population in the country.

It is however unfortunate that the majority of these women still face a lot of discrimination and maltreatment from the male gender and even the laws of the country that is meant to protect them.


We take a look at ten bizarre and discriminatory laws against women in Africa’s most populous country.

1) Domestic Violence : Section 55 (1) (d) of the Penal Code applicable in the Northern Nigeria makes it lawful for a man to beat his wife for the purpose of correcting her as long as it doesn’t supposedly lead to grievous bodily harm . Weird right? I can imagine the man throwing some Jet li kicks and Muhammed Ali punches on his wife with the defence of ‘correction’ as provided under this law. This section allows for the abuse of the woman by her husband when she supposedly misbehaves or frustrates the husband. This provision is barbaric and one of the numerous laws that allows the male gender to maltreat women in Nigeria.



2) Labour Law: The Labour Act of Nigeria prohibits women employed in certain industries from working night shifts. Section 55 Labour Act of Nigeria states that except for nurses, women are not to be employed for night work in any public or private industrial undertaking or in any agricultural undertaking. Women who are committed to working hard are denied the opportunity to do so and consequentially, they are denied the opportunity to earn more by the provisions of this law.



3) Sexual Assault: The Penal code states that sexual intercourse by a man with his wife does not amount to rape if such a lady has attained puberty. As such, the offence of marital rape is not provided for under the Nigerian law. Section 182 of the Penal Code which is applicable in Northern Nigeria affirms the position that a man cannot be said to have raped his wife not taking into cognizance the fact that the sex was forcefully obtained from the wife.



4) Married Women : Married women are prevented from enlisting in the Nigerian Police force under Section 127 of the Police Act . An unmarried police woman that is found to be pregnant would be immediately discharged from the Police Force. This provision surprisingly does not apply to married men. A woman that is also single at the time of her enlistment must have also spent three years in active service before she applies for permission to marry and she must give particulars of her fiancé who must be investigated and cleared before such permission for marriage is given according to Section 124 of the country’s Police Act.


5) Rape Victims: Section 221 of the Criminal Code of Southern Nigeria where it states that when it relates to the defilement of girls less than 16 years, a person cannot be convicted of the offence of unlawful carnal knowledge of a girl being or above thirteen years and under sixteen years of age on the uncorroborated evidence of one witness. This simply states that more than one person must be present at the scene of the rape incident else the claim that a female was raped will fail in the court of law. Weird!


6) Different Punishment : Indecent assault against male and female carry different punishment under the Nigerian law. While an individual that commits an indecent assault on a male is guilty of a felony and liable to an imprisonment of three years by virtue of section 353 of the criminal code, an individual that indecently assaults a woman is guilty of misdemeanour and is liable to an imprisonment of two years by virtue of section 360 of the criminal code . It is clear that an assault on a man is given a stricter punishment than an assault on a woman and once again shows the discrimination against women inherent in Nigerian laws.


7) Consent Before Marriage: Section 18 of the Marriage Act states that the consent of the father of either party to an intended marriage is required if either of the parties are under the age of 21 years. It is clear that even though two people gave birth to the kids, only the father’s consent is made mandatory under the Nigerian law, a pointer to the utter disregard of women which is evident in the Marriage Act of the country. It is only when the father is of unsound mind, dead or out of Nigeria that the consent of the woman must be sort thus relegating the position of the woman.


8 ) Passport and Citizenship: – Section 26 of the 1999 constitution as amended provides that a woman can be conferred citizenship upon being married to a citizen of Nigeria but similar provision is not made when a man is married to a Nigerian woman. As a matter of fact, this law resulted in the deportation of Dr Patrick Wilmot, a Jamaican from Nigeria by the Ibrahim Babangida administration even though his wife is a Nigerian citizen from Sokoto state.


9) Customary Law: Customary law refers to the customs and practices of the people of Nigeria spread across ethnic divides. Under most customary laws in Nigeria, a woman cannot inherit property in Nigeria. The Oli Ekpe custom for example gives the son of the brother to the deceased rights over the property even more than the first female child. In the Igbo tribe of Nigeria also, the custom doesn’t allow for the female children to inherit anything. The inheritance rules of the Igbo ethnic group appear to largely favour male offspring over female offspring of a deceased person. For instance, although many local variations exist, inheritance of individually owned land generally follows the principle of primogeniture.


10) Political Discrimination: Section 131 of the Nigerian constitution uses the word “he” while listing qualifications for the office of the president insinuating that only a man can be a president. The constitution generally uses the he, his, him and doesn’t include female pronouns. The word ‘he’ appears about 236 times in the Nigerian constitution. It seems like the Nigerian constitution doesn’t believe in female presidents. Strange!

WHAT IS ENTERTAINMENT LAW ?

Entertainment law has no universal definition .

The Black’s Law Dictionary defines Entertainment Law as “ The field of law dealing with the legal and business issues in the entertainment industry (such as film , music and theatre ) and involving the representation of artists and producers , the negotiation of contracts and the protection of intellectual property rights “.

Entertainment law can also be defined as the aspect of law that regulates , protects and interprets services , rights and acts inherent in the different facets of the entertainment industry .

To further buttress the above definition , Entertainment law can simply defined as all legal services that is associated with the entertainment industry i.e the entirety of legal provisions and services relevant to the entertainment industry .

As such , entertainment law covers music , comedy , film and television , broadcasts , fashion , tourism, sports , event management, photography , NFTs and many more aspects of entertainment.

WHO IS AN ENTERTAINMENT LAWYER ?

In very simple terms , An entertainment lawyer is a lawyer with expertise in Entertainment Law and Intellectual Property .

While a lot of people use the term interchangeably , it should be stated that intellectual property is just a significant part of entertainment law and should not be substituted with entertainment law . Entertainment law is broad and Intellectual property is a simply segment of it .

An entertainment lawyer should be someone that is creative and has passion for creativity. This is the edge and driving factor that will enable the entertainment lawyer deliver better results to clients as he or she can relate more with their issues and problems besieging their creative client or business .

Entertainment lawyers in Nigeria represent and protect the interests of creatives, companies , entertainment business professionals and other stakeholders in the many areas of the entertainment industry in Nigeria, such as film, television, new media, theater, branding , sports , licensing , print , publishing and music among others . They also advise these individuals and entities on legal matter and general industry Practice relating to these facets of the entertainment field.

What Works Are Eligible For Copyright ?

There are Certain Categories  of Creative Works that fall under the Copyright Aspect of Intellectual Property law in Nigeria .

The Categories are
1) Literary Works 
2) Musical Works
3) Artistic Works
4) Cinematograph films
5) Sound Recordings 
6) Broadcasts

We are going to examine the categories that are quite relevant to Creatives .

1) Literary Works -  For Literary works , there is no requirement that the literary work must be in a particular language or that the literary work must be interesting or Noble laureate worthy . Irrespective of the quality of the literary work, as long as the two conditions for eligibility are met , your literary work posseses copyright and can be registered .Example of literary works are 
(a) novels, stories and poetical works;
(b) plays, stage directions, film scenarios and broadcasting scripts;
(c) choreographic works;
(d) computer programmes;
(e) text-books, treaties, histories, biographies, essays and articles;
(f) encyclopaedias, dictionaries, directories and anthologies;
(g) letters, reports and memoranda;
(h) lectures, addresses and sermons;
(i) law reports, excluding decisions of courts;
(j) written tables or compilations;
(k) articles 
 
2) Musical Works - Same with literary works , your song need not be sweet or belong to a particular genre , once it is original and accessible in a fixed form , it possesses Copyright and qualified for registration.  Musical works does not refer to songs alone . Acapella performance ,Eulogys, Odes, among others  all enjoy the Copyright Aspect of Intellectual Property . A musical work can therefore be seen as any combination of melody and harmony or either of them which may be printed, reduced to writing, graphically produced or represented or recorded.Example of musical works are

a) Odes
b) Lullabies
c) Song lyrics
d) Written melodies 
e) Music Demos
f) Instrumentals
g) Beat packs
 
3) Artistic Works - Irrespective of artistic quality, any of the following works or works similar thereto falls under artistic works  and enjoy the benefits imbedded under Copyright , an aspect of Intellectual Property Law 

(a) paintings, drawings, etchings, lithographs, woodcuts, engravings and prints;
(b) maps, plans and diagrams;
(c) works of sculpture;
(d) photographs not comprised in a cinematograph film;
(e) works of architecture in the form of buildings models
(f) Computer programs
 
4) Cinematograph Films -  Example of Cinematograph Films that can be Copyrighted are 

a) Movies 
b) Short Films
c) Skits 
d) Dance Drama 
e) Comedy Shows
f) PowerPoint presentation 
 
5) Sound Recording - ( With the exception of sound recordings used in a Cinematograph film)

1) Podcasts
2) WhatsApp Voice notes 
3) Spoken words

Music/RadioTop Five Hottest Dance Styles In Nigerian Music Industry 2021 by Synord(op): 3:49pm On Dec 17, 2021
TOP FIVE HOTTEST DANCE STYLES IN NIGERIAN MUSIC INDUSTRY 2021

The Nigerian Music Industry in 2021 has witnessed a lot of growth and progress in terms of lyrics , Production quality , global audience acceptance etc . The year also witnessed the creation of new and exciting dance steps that became popular and the go to dance routines for the numerous hit songs released this year .

We briefly take a lot at the top five dance styles that evolved in the year 2021

1) FOCUS DANCE. : Street Pop Producer , Ajinomoix beat produced the viral instrumental beat titled “Focus”. The dance was popularized by dancers , hagmandc and abatiade on the social media platform – Instagram.

The song has achieved critical success and entered the top 100 trends on TikTok as well as getting endorsements from stars like Micheal Blackson, Davido, Pogba, Burna Boy and many more. The Remix of the song with Dice Ailes has amassed over 500k views on YouTube . The focus dance remains one of the most successful dance styles to come out of Nigeria this year.


2 ) ANOTI DANCE : Wizkid released the deluxe version of his Critically acclaimed Made in Lagos album in August , 2021. A standout from the deluxe album is the Afrobeats tune and P-prime produced single “ Anoti” which also came with a new dance step . Wizkid teased the dance step on his IG almost two months before the deluxe release and the dance became quite popular upon release leading to anoti dance challenge on social media platforms Instagram and TikTok.


3) CHO CHO – Zlatan Featured Mayorkun and Davido on the single “ Cho Cho “ released in April , 2021 . The P prime produced joint is an uptempo joint that also came with the energetic cho Cho dance style which was quite popular in the country . The Winner of the Cho Cho Dance Challenge went home with a Million Naira .


4 ) PERUZZI STAMINA DANCE – Peruzzi Created the Stamina Dance which mirrored the strength of an ape and connotes stamina . The dance was featured in some of Peruzzi’s singles released in 2021 including Lagbaja, Somebody Baby and Sweetah .


5 ) AMAPIANO/ HAPPY FEET – As the popularity of the South Africa Originated music style “‘Amapiano “ grew, so did a couple of dance styles . The Happy feet dance and other dance steps generally associated with the Amapiano genre were also quite popular this year .
